Now we are entering into a new year you might think it’s time to brighten up your home ready for the months to come. It can cost a fortune to hire a builder or decorator, so here are five simple ways to update your home without knocking down walls and ceilings.

  1. Make your garden something to be proud of

When someone comes to visit you the first thing they will see is your front garden and first impressions always count. If the space in front of your home is bare then buying some plants or shrubs online from Ashridge Nurseries will add some much needed color and cover up any ungainly pipes or fencing. The garden at the rear of your home can be landscaped, but take into account any pets or children that will be using the space before you start working.

  1. Add some color

It’s important that the exterior of your home looks smart, and a quick coat of paint can do wonders. An article in the Telegraph, interviewing property developer Phil Spencer, says that he recommends painting the outside of your home so that you don’t lose any value on your property. This renovation will also ensure that your exterior walls stay in good condition; the same applies to the interior. A color scheme you had a few years ago might start to look tired, so repainting the walls a new color will freshen it up.

  1.  3. Using technology

Most people in today’s world have a smart phone and if you want to keep your home up to date you can download a wide variety of apps that will help you monitor your home from a distance. The Guardian explains how smart technologies can be used to control your heating too by just sending a message from your phone or laptop to your thermostat. These devices can help you save money. If you have a burglar alarm app you’ll also protect your property from intruders, so updating your home’s technology can make life a lot easier.

  1. Small spaces and mirrors

If your home is on the small side a good way to make a room or passageway look larger is to hang big mirrors. It’s also important that you have bright colors to help reflect any light that you have coming in. You can also make a space look bigger with the use of well placed lighting. These lights can either be hidden in the ceiling or you can install up-lighting on the walls. There is nothing worse than a dark and dingy room.

  1. Brighten up the kitchen

Many families use the kitchen as their main room for sitting and working. Giving your kitchen a quick makeover can be carried out by simply changing the handles on the drawers or cupboards. Another cheap way to brighten up the kitchen is to remove the fronts of the units so that you can re-spray them. This will be cheaper than buying new doors and will not take you too long. You can also make an area look fresher by hanging new pictures on the walls.
